Pharaonic Granite:
Refers to a type of granite widely used by the ancient Egyptians during the Pharaonic period (c. 3100 to 30 BC). Granite is an igneous rock composed primarily of quartz, feldspar, and mica, and is known for its hardness and durability. These qualities made it a valuable material in ancient Egypt, especially for the construction of monumental structures, statues, and other timeless artifacts.

Pharaonic schist:

Refers to a variety of metamorphic stones widely used by the ancient Egyptians from 3100 to 30 BC. This stone is characterized by its layered composition, which facilitates its shaping and carving. Schist is composed of minerals such as mica, chlorite, and talc, giving it a lustrous sheen and a smooth surface. These qualities made it a valuable material for fine sculptures, ritual objects, and funerary items. The ancient Egyptians preferred schist for its ability to support intricate carvings, making it a prime material for temple statues, stelae, and tomb artifacts, which often held religious significance.

Pharaonic Basalt:

Pharaonic basalt refers to the igneous volcanic rock used by the ancient Egyptians during the Pharaonic period (c. 3100–30 BC) for various artistic, ritual, and functional purposes. Basalt is a dense, hard, dark stone, usually black or dark gray, formed from cooled lava. Its durability and fine grain make it particularly suitable for fine carving and long-lasting monuments.

Cleopatra VII, the last queen of the Ptolemaic dynasty, was known not only for her remarkable beauty but also for her political acumen, intellect, and diplomatic genius.

She forged alliances with some of Rome’s greatest leaders, Julius Caesar and Mark Antony, and ruled Egypt during a time of great turbulence. Cleopatra's legacy is one of power and grace, forever etched into the annals of history as the Queen of the Nile.
